As they talked in the realms of philosophy and religion, she realized that perhaps, she was better off than she had initially thought. If it wasn't for her wandering into a tent and taking part in a ten minutes Japanese Tea Ceremony over 20 years ago, would she be sitting across from her companion in a completely different state? If she hadn't rebelled against her father and his dislike for all things Asian, would she have held onto the belief that brewing Tea was a waste of time? She shook her head no and then took a sip of her cooling Darjeeling, while her boyfriend got up to make pancakes for them. She relaxed in her high backed chair and sighed. It's amazing how one flap of a butterfly wing can change the world, she said to herself. Her boyfriend asked her if she wanted blueberries on top, to which she said yes. Perhaps that's my wings causing a tsunami in Kansas, she thought as she sighed again.
